JEE Advanced 2026 Admit Card Release Date
The JEE Advanced 2026 exam date is on Sunday, May 17, 2026, at IIT Roorkee. The admit card will be released on the website tentatively on May 11, 2026. Also, the JEE Advanced 2026 registration has started from April 23, 2026, and the deadline to apply and fill the application form is May 2, 2026.
And students will be able to download the admit card until the day of the exam. Students are advised to download and get a printout of the admit card as early as possible to avoid any delays and lags. The table below has all the important dates with time with respect to the JEE Advanced 2026 admit card date:
| Particulars | Details |
| JEE Advanced admit card 2026 release date | May 11, 2026 |
| JEE Advanced admit card 2026 time | 10:30 AM (tentative) |
| Advanced admit card 2026 deadline | May 17, 2026 |
| JEE Advanced 2026 exam date | May 17, 2026 |
| JEE Advanced 2026 exam time | • Paper 1: 9 AM to 12 PM • Paper 2: 2:30 PM to 5:30 PM |

Steps to Download the JEE Advanced 2026 Admit Card
Students can click on the JEE Advanced 2026 admit card download link given above to be redirected to the official page. Or students can follow the steps given below to download the admit card from the official JEE Advanced website. Once the admit card is released, students will find the link on the JEE Advanced website, which is jeeadv.ac.in.
Step 1: Visit the JEE Advanced website, jeeadv.ac.in.
Step 2: Find the link – JEE Advanced 2026 download link.
Step 3: The admit card login page will open.
Step 4: Enter your JEE Advanced 2026 registration or application number.
Step 5: Enter the password and the captcha and click on submit.
Step 6: The admit card will appear on the screen once the correct details are entered.
Step 7: Students can download the admit card and take a printout of it.
Candidates can cross-check their personal details and verify that all details are correctly spelt.

Are you Facing Issues During JEE Advanced 2026 Admit Card Download?
It is possible that candidates might face issues like technical difficulties while downloading the JEE Advanced 2026 admit card. But this becomes a moment of panic for many students. Here is what students can do if facing problems while downloading the admit card:
- If the website is slow and unresponsive, this happens due to heavy traffic. In this case, try waiting for some time and logging in again. Or try to download the admit card in non-peak hours, which are early morning or late night.
- In case it shows that the login credentials are incorrect, here is what to check. Double-check the registration number and password you are entering. In case you forgot the password, click on the “Forgot Password” option to create a new one.
- Candidates can retrieve a forgotten registration number as well, using their JEE Main application number and date of birth via the candidate portal.
- If the admit card is not loading completely or it is showing as blank, clear your browser cookies and cache. Or try in a different browser like Firefox or Edge.
If none of the above solutions works, candidates should immediately contact the JEE Advanced 2026 helpline number or send an email to the official IIT Roorkee mail ID.

Documents Required at the JEE Advanced 2026 Exam Centre
The JEE Advanced 2026 admit card is the most important document that students are supposed to carry to the examination centre. Candidates are supposed to carry other important documents along with the admit card to the exam centre on May 17, 2026, without fail. Failing to bring any of the following documents might result in denial of entry:
- JEE Advanced 2026 admit card (colour printout preferred)
- Valid original photo identity proof – any one of the following: Aadhaar card, passport, PAN card, voter ID, or driving licence
- PwD certificate (if applicable)
JEE Advanced 2026 Exam Date and Time
The JEE Advanced 2026 exam is scheduled to be conducted on May 17, 2026. There will be 2 papers that students have to give. Both papers are of 3 hours time duration. The table below showcases the JEE Advanced 2026 date and time of both papers:
| Particulars | Paper 1 Time | Paper 2 Time |
| Entry at the exam centre | 7:00 AM onwards | 7:00 AM onwards |
| Gates close at the exam centre | By 8:30 AM | By 2:00 PM |
| Exam start time | 9:00 AM | 2:30 PM |
| Exam end time | 12:00 Noon | 5:30 PM |
